- The distance between Vaernes, Norway and Hoseda-Hard, Russia is approximately 2,231 km or 1,387 mi.
- To reach Vaernes in this distance one would set out from Hoseda-Hard bearing 282.8°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Vaernes bearing 238.3° or WSW .
- Both have a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Vaernes is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Hoseda-Hard is in or near the subpolar wet tundra biome.
- The average annual temperature is 10.6 °C (19°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 17.4 °C (31.3°F) less in Vaernes.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 437.1 mm (17.2 in) more which is equivalent to 437.1 l/m² (10.73 US gal/ft²) or 4,371,000 l/ha (467,289 US gal/ac) more. About 2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3.5° higher in Vaernes than in Hoseda-Hard.
